2012-03-19 58 views
2

我为Vim制作了一个colorscheme,并且有一个命令可以查看属性的'范围'以突出显示,但我需要一些常规属性(背景,行号等),以便我可以正确地创建我的方案。有没有好的备忘单或某些属性列表?我检查了所有的Vim文档和wiki,但是他们没有列出很多影响编辑器的东西。Vim colorscheme的一般属性?

回答

4

是的,有这样一个列表。所有你需要的是在Vim的绝对完美 - 但是有时 - 神秘的文档::help syntax,更具体地说:help highlight-default为默认突出显示组的列表。如果某些东西不存在,那可能意味着它不能完成或者它是自定义/语法相关的。

您也可以打开预先存在的colorscheme并查看它是如何完成的。实际上,理解语法的工作原理并不复杂。

祝你好运,并确保在社区准备好时与你的颜色分享。

+0

非常感谢,Vim的可怕文档有点难以找到,但一旦找到它就会很有帮助。 – beakr 2012-03-19 12:48:59

+0

好的建议检查现有的方案。 – moodywoody 2012-03-19 12:49:54

+0

@Beakr,当通常的':help yourterm'将你引向错误的地方太多次时,你可以执行':helpgrep yourterm'。 – romainl 2012-03-19 13:55:24

0

可能你会发现有用的这个colorscheme:http://www.vim.org/scripts/script.php?script_id=106

下面就是笔者给出的描述:

这里的理念是为所有重要的群体提供增亮命令的现成取消注释列表。然后你可以偏离默认值,直到你想出一个你喜欢的。